Meanings

failing to notice or consider important information or facts that are available.

The detective was criticized for overlooking evidence that could have solved the case.

to disregard or dismiss evidence that contradicts one's beliefs or assumptions.

The jury was accused of overlooking evidence that didn't fit their preconceived notions.
